首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
给定程序中,函数fun的功能是:计算出形参s所指字符串中包含的单词个数,作为函数值返回。为便于统计,规定各单词之间用空格隔开。 例如,形参s所指的字符串为:This is a C languageprogram,函数的返回值为6。 请在程序
给定程序中,函数fun的功能是:计算出形参s所指字符串中包含的单词个数,作为函数值返回。为便于统计,规定各单词之间用空格隔开。 例如,形参s所指的字符串为:This is a C languageprogram,函数的返回值为6。 请在程序
admin
2017-03-24
80
问题
给定程序中,函数fun的功能是:计算出形参s所指字符串中包含的单词个数,作为函数值返回。为便于统计,规定各单词之间用空格隔开。
例如,形参s所指的字符串为:This is a C languageprogram,函数的返回值为6。
请在程序的下划线处填入正确的内容并把下划线删除,使程序得出正确的结果。
注意:源程序存放在考生文件夹下的BLANK1.C中。
不得增行或删行,也不得更改程序的结构!
1 #include<stdio.h>
2 int fun(char *s)
3 { int n=0,flag=0;
4 while(* s!=’\0’)
5 { if(*s!=’ ’&&flag==0){
6 /**********found**********/
7 __1__;flag=1 ;}
8 /**********found**********/
9 if(*s==’ ’)flag=__2__;
10 /**********found**********/
11 __3__;
12 }
13 return n;
14 }
15 main()
16 { char str[81];int n;
17 printf(’’\nEnter a line text:\n’’); gets(str);
18 n=fun(str);
19 printf(’’\nThere are %d words in this text.\n\n’’,n);
20 }
选项
答案
(1)n++ (2)0 (3)s++
解析
函数fun的功能是计算出形参s所指字符串中包含的单词个数。
第一空:“if(*s!=’’&&flag==0)”说明找到空格了,单词的数量应加1,故第一空处应为“n++”。
第二空:“if(*s!=’ ’&&flag==0)”和“if(*s==’ ’)flag=__2__;”在flag为0的情况下,n才加1,因此第二空处是将flag置0,即第二空处应为“0”。
第三空:“while(*s!=’\0’)”循环的终止条件是s达到结尾,因此在循环体内s应该不断往字符串尾移动,即第三空为“s++”。
转载请注明原文地址:https://kaotiyun.com/show/90ID777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
根据以下资料,回答以下问题。截至2011年底,我国石油剩余技术可采储量32.4亿吨,天然气4.02万亿方;煤炭查明资源储量1.38万亿吨,铁矿743.9亿吨,铜矿8612万吨,铝土矿38.7亿吨,金矿7419吨。2011年我国矿产资源勘
根据“以事实为依据,以法律为准绳”的原则,人民法院审理案件所应依据的事实是()。
甲为某汽配店员工,一日和老板乙一起外出送货,甲趁乙和经销商对账时,便携带乙让自己代为看管的5万货款潜逃。甲的行为构成()。
我国是统一的多民族国家,下列关于我国国家结构形式的表述,不正确的是()。
太平洋战争时期,一艘航空母舰在战斗中遭受敌军攻击,左舷中弹进水,舰上燃起大火,下列紧急处理方式错误的是()。
“咏史怀古诗”是我国古代诗词中的一个重要组成部分。下列咏史怀古诗所描写的历史典故,按时间先后顺序排列正确的是()。①可怜夜半虚前席,不问苍生问鬼神②如何一别朱仙镇,不见将军奏凯歌③王浚楼船下益州,金陵王气黯然收④易水潺谖云草碧,可怜无处送荆
下列诗句描述与城市之间对应关系错误的是()。
根据下列材料回答问题。S省统计局日前发布((2014年S省果业发展统计公报》,初步核算,2014年全省果业增加值达320亿元,比上年增加3.5%,占全省种植业增加值的30.2%,比上年提高0.1%。2014年,苹果、梨、柑橘、猕猴桃和红枣等
传统家训家规是我国古代以家庭为范围的道德教育形式,也是中华道德文化传承的一种方式。我国历史上流传下来的家训家规,始作者多是文化名人或著名官宦,社会影响较为广泛。这些家训家规的功能远远超出对本家族的教育作用,而成为社会教育的一种独特形式,为社会提供了家庭教育
神经胶质细胞的功能有
随机试题
课外校外教育指_____有计划、有目的、有组织的教育活动()
不用炒炭法炮制的药材是
根据《证券投资基金法》的规定,下列事项应当通过召开基金份额持有人大会审议决定的是?
下列哪种房地产不是按其经营使用方式来划分的()。
(2008)关于住宅层数变化对规划产生的影响,以下哪项不正确?
背景某框架剪力墙结构,框架柱间距9m,普通梁板结构,三层楼板施工当天气温为35℃,没有雨,施工单位制定了完整的施工方案,采用预拌混凝土,钢筋现场加工,采用多层板模板碗扣支撑,架子工搭设完支撑架后由木工制作好后直接拼装梁板模板,其施工过程如下:模板安装用具
“备案号”栏应填写()。“运输方式”栏应填写()。
邓小平指出:“不讲多劳多得,不重视物质利益,对少数先进分子可以,对广大群众不行,一段时间可以,长期不行。革命精神是非常宝贵的,没有革命精神就没有革命行动。但是,革命是在物质利益的基础上产生的,如果只讲牺牲精神,不讲物质利益,那就是唯心论。”这段话意在强调把
《权利法案》是英国政治史上的重要文件,下列各点属于该文件内容的是( )①国王无权废除法律或停止法律的执行;②人生来是自由的,并且在权利上是平等的;③不经议会同意,国王不能征税,不能在和平时期维持常备军;④议会有权监督国王大臣的活动
阅读以下文字,回答以下问题。这种群体意见通过传染、暗示、联想,结成了一种共同心理,把人们链接在一起,成为“粉群体”。他们能以最快的速度聚合,这种结合并非源于相同的阶层、职业、地域等关系,而仅仅是出于相同或近似的情绪、意见与态度。“粉”与“粉”之间
最新回复
(
0
)